ORA-12547 TNS contact错误详解 1. 错误含义 ORA-12547 TNS contact 是一个 Oracle 数据库错误,表示客户端与服务器之间的网络连接在通信过程中意外中断。这通常发生在尝试执行数据库操作时,如查询、更新或连接数据库本身。 2. 常见原因 网络问题:网络不稳定、延迟高或中断都可能导致此错误。 防火墙或安全设置:防火...
在执行“sqlplus / as sysdba”时可能会报“ORA-12547: TNS:lost contact”的错误,常见原因有如下几点:1、查看操作系统内核参数是否无误2、确认$ORACLE_HOME/bin/oracle文件权限和属主是否有问题3、检查一下环境变量4、检查$ORACLE_HOME/bin/oracle和$ORACLE_HOME/rdbms/lib/config.o的文件大小是否为05、检查$O...
Asm启动过程中报InstConnection:connect:excp OCIException OCI error 12547之后启动失败。 我们发现sqlplus / as sysdba登录也会出现TNS 12547的报错 通过truss 去跟踪sqlplus: 发现在读写sqlnet.log 时候报错,怀疑是oracle本身有问题,查询metalink证实了这个想法:Troubleshooting ORA-12547 TNS: Lost Contact [ID 555565.1...
遇到"ORA-12547: TNS:lost contact"错误,通常需要排查以下几个方面的原因:首先,确认操作系统内核参数设置是否正确无误。 检查$ORACLE_HOME/bin/oracle文件的权限和所有权,确保它们没有问题。 环境变量的设置也需要检查,确保它们与Oracle环境兼容。 对比$ORACLE_HOME/bin/oracle和$ORACLE_HOME/rdbm...
墨墨导读:一个诡异的案例:ORA-12547: TNS:lost contact导致数据库无法启动,甚至sqlplus都无法登录,让我们一一来解开这个案例的真面目。 1. 背景概述 某客户出现数据库无法启动的情况,申请云和恩墨协助分析和处置。 云和恩墨工程师快速响应,组织相关人员进行故障诊断分析、指出故障原因,提出解决措施并处置,快速恢复了业务...
在安装数据库时,遇到了ORA-12547报错问题,无论是使用dbca创建数据库,还是使用conn / as sysdba尝试连接,都遇到了"ORA-12547: TNS:lost contact"错误。初步分析认为内核参数问题或LD_LIBRARY_PATH环境变量设置不当可能导致此问题。在检查内核参数和LD_LIBRARY_PATH环境变量后,发现在不设置该环境变量的...
在命令启动oracle时,出现ORA-12547: TNS:lost contact错误,。中午好好的纳,下午就不管了。以为是链接失效,关机重启后还是不行。然后google了一把,找到了下面的解决方法。回想了一下,引起的原因是权限的问题,中午的时候不小心该了oracle安装目录的文件夹的权限,看来oracle的权限不能随便改动。 Cause 1. This could...
ORA-12547:TNS:lost contact 问题分析思路 ORA-12547:TNS:lost contact sqlplus无法正常登陆数据库 解决思路如下: 1、查看操作系统内核参数是否无误 [oracle@normal adump]$ ulimit -a core file size (blocks, -c) 0 data seg size (kbytes, -d) unlimited scheduling priority (-e) 0 file ...
ORA-12547:TNS:lostcontact SQL>quit Disconnected 错误原因可能是libaio的rpm包没有装,su到root检验一下 [oracle@redhat4U4~]$exit logout 如果有话,可以查到以下: [root@redhat4U4~]#rpm-qa|greplibaio libaio-devel-0.3.105-2 libaio-0.3.105-2 结果没有发现这两个包,于是到第三张安装盘里...
ORA-12547: TNS:lost contact 起初以为是oracle_home目录的权限不够,给了最大的权限仍然报同样的错误。在root用户下通过网络服务名可以连接成功就是通过系统认证一直不成功,说明我的环境变量没有问题。通过一位朋友的帮助,查了oracle的maintant link。获取如下信息: ...